I think it'd be much simpler and much safer to rent for the maximum and possibly return early, and just realize that depending on how early you return it and also depending on the rental agency you may or may not get any refund. Rates are often "weekly" rates past a certain number of days, and in that case any shortening from 7 days to that number of days may not change the rate.) But the rental company won't expect you back before the maximum, so if you come back early that's good news for them.

On the other hand, if you rent for the minimum, and then there turn out to be problems with extending it, you could face steep fines for not returning on time. Don't assume you can necessarily extend it. The rental company will be expecting you back at the minimum days (if that's what you rent for), and if you come back late (or just ask to extend it) that's bad news for them (especially if they don't have plenty of extra stock).

Lots of rental companies are short on stock right now (because they sold off a bunch at the start of the pandemic and haven't been able to re-stock due to the car-makers' chip shortages), and you want to keep that in mind with all rental decisions you make.
